电子病历的电子签名通常涉及到一个叫做“数字签名”的技术。数字签名是一种加密技术,用于验证数据的真实性和完整性。在电子病历中,医生或医疗机构可能会使用数字签名来确认病历信息的正确性和完整性。
数字签名通常由以下几部分组成:
1. 私钥(Private Key):这是用于加密和解密数据的密钥。只有拥有私钥的人才能对数据进行加密和解密。私钥通常存储在安全的地方,如硬件钱包、USB驱动器等。
2. 公钥(Public Key):这是公开的密钥,用于加密和解密数据。任何人都可以使用公钥来加密数据,而只有拥有私钥的人才能解密数据。公钥通常与私钥一起存储,以便进行身份验证和数据加密。
3. 证书(Certificate):这是一种证明私钥所有权的文件。证书通常由权威机构颁发,以确保私钥的安全性。证书可以包含证书颁发机构(CA)的公钥、证书持有者的公钥以及证书的有效期等信息。
4. 签名算法(Signature Algorithm):这是一种用于生成数字签名的算法。常见的签名算法有RSA、DSA等。签名算法将私钥和数据结合起来,生成一个唯一的数字签名。
在电子病历中,医生或医疗机构可能会使用数字签名来确保病历信息的真实性和完整性。例如,他们可能会使用自己的私钥对病历信息进行加密,然后使用公钥对加密后的信息进行解密,从而验证病历信息的真实性。此外,他们还可以使用数字签名来确认病历信息的完整性,防止篡改和伪造。
总之,电子病历的电子签名涉及到数字签名技术,包括私钥、公钥、证书和签名算法等部分。这些技术共同确保了电子病历信息的真实性、完整性和安全性。